    Catching up.

    Gala Madrid - Peterson, AM'71, oldie form with almost dog ear falls.



    Galway - Keppel, HM'99, IB



    Glad Choice - Pierce, HM'99, had to angle the camera to capture color.



    Gladys Austin- Osborne, HM'87, SA, awful pic. and didn't save original to improve. Falls are a violet-lavender. A very cheerful iris.



    Golden Galaxy - at least that is how it was sold. I have my doubts. It was part of the entirely mis-labeled order.

    a few more oldie G's (tall beardeds)

    Gnus Flash - again, showing the burgundy shade.


    Grand Circle - Sutton, HM'06, a very pretty iris, shall buy this year.


    Grand Old Opry - Meek'87, no awards but I love this iris' color and form. Five years to bloom because it was in too much shade.


    Grape Parfait - MLauer, HM'10


    Gypsy Belle - Hamner, AM;79, a clump of these knocks your socks off.


    She is impossible. Not as rose as above and not as brown as below.


    Gypsy Romance - Schreiner, AM'98, I laid in wait with a tripod to capture the rich gorgeous color of this one. Finally close to 6 pm. a picture came true.


    As she ages her standards open.
